'Passion, positivity and precision ... and always be willing to learn something new.'

Athlete Andrew Henderson was just sixteen years old when a horrific rugby injury put paid to his career in the game. So he turned his attention to football - more specifically, freestyling football skills - and never looked back. Now a five-time World Freestyling Champion and the UK Freestyle football champion for eight years running, in this unique manual Andrew brings together all his expertise and advice to help make you a better
footballer.

Packed with tips, tricks and over 200 colour photographs, Andrew reveals how hard work, dedication and flair allowed him to become a master on the football pitch and beyond. Having worked with Cristiano Ronaldo, impressed the likes of David Beckham and Neymar, to performing at the opening ceremonies of the Olympics and various World Cups around the world, he is now sharing all his secrets and famous freestyling skills to help you improve your football techniques and take them onto the pitch.

Interspersed with the jaw-dropping tricks, guidance on tackling, fundamental skills and tips on advancing your expertise, Andrew's passionate advice about following a dream and overcoming adversity prove that both enthusiasm and patience play a major part in any sporting arena. This isn't only about teaching the physical elements but learning from a master about how to focus your mentality to bring flair, passion and precision to your game.

About the author

Andrew Henderson grew up in Cornwall with a passion for sport. A keen rugby player, in 2008 he suffered a horrific leg break in a championship game that put his career on hold. After doctors told him he may never be able to play sport again, he decided to never give up and less than two years later, at the age of seventeen he became the youngest national champion in the history of football freestyling. Andrew won his first world championship title at nineteen and now holds five world championship titles, making him the greatest freestyle footballer of all time.
